1. The Profit & Loss Statement: Your Business Scoreboard
This foundational report should be your first stop. The Profit & Loss (P&L) statement summarizes your total income, expenses, and net profit or loss over a specified period. Regularly reviewing your P&L allows you to catch rising costs and measure the effectiveness of marketing efforts, thus keeping your business on a sound financial footing.
2. Understanding Your Financial Position with a Balance Sheet
The balance sheet offers a snapshot of your assets, liabilities, and equity at a single point in time. It helps business owners comprehend their company’s financial stability and value, thereby allowing informed strategic decisions. Knowing what you own versus what you owe is paramount for long-term planning.
3. Cash Flow Statement: Tracking Your Money's Movement
The cash flow statement provides a detailed account of how money flows into and out of your business. This report includes cash inflows from sales and investments and outflows such as expenses and payroll. Monitoring cash flow is critical, particularly in growth phases, ensuring that you are not caught off guard by potential cash shortfalls.
